What is your policy on grooming double-coated breeds common in the area, like Australian Shepherds or Border Collies, to ensure their coat is properly maintained for our climate?

We follow a 'de-shed, don't shave' philosophy for double-coated breeds. Shaving can ruin their coat's insulation and temperature regulation, which is crucial for both our cool winters and warm summers. Our service includes a high-velocity blow-out to remove the loose undercoat, followed by specialized brushing techniques. This dramatically reduces shedding while preserving the healthy, protective qualities of their coat for Cullowhee's variable mountain weather.

Beyond the Bath: Why a Cullowhee Pet Spa is Essential for Our Mountain Companions

Living in Cullowhee, our lives are beautifully intertwined with the outdoors. From hikes along the Tuckasegee River to exploring the trails near Western Carolina University, our furry friends are right there with us, collecting more than just memories. They gather burrs from the dense underbrush, layers of red clay dust, and pollen from our vibrant mountain flora. That’s where the concept of a professional pet grooming spa moves from a luxury to a vital part of responsible pet care in our community. It’s about more than a cute haircut; it’s about maintaining health and comfort for our adventurous companions.

A true pet grooming spa experience addresses the unique challenges our Cullowhee pets face. That thick double coat on your Husky or Shepherd? It’s essential for winter warmth but can become a matted, overheated burden in our humid summers. A skilled groomer doesn’t just shave it down; they expertly de-shed and thin the coat to promote better air circulation. For those post-hike paw inspections, a spa session includes a thorough nail trim, pad check for cuts or embedded gravel, and a soothing paw balm treatment to combat cracked pads from our rocky paths.

Let’s talk about the local irritants. Our area is lush, which means ticks and fleas are a constant concern. A grooming spa visit starts with a careful brush-out to remove loose hair and debris, often revealing hidden hitchhikers. The high-quality, hypoallergenic shampoos used can soothe skin irritated by seasonal allergies, which are common here, and leave a coat that’s less attractive to pests. It’s a proactive step in your pet’s parasite defense plan, complementing your regular preventatives.

For Cullowhee pet owners, choosing a local spa means supporting a neighbor who understands our specific environment. They know which weeds cause irritation and how to gently remove stubborn sap or pine pitch. It’s also a wonderful opportunity for socialization in a calm setting, which is great for puppies or pets who might feel anxious around the bustling energy of Sylva or Cherokee.

To make the most of your pet’s spa day, communicate with your groomer. Tell them about your last adventure—was it a swim in the river or a dusty walk on a forest service road? Schedule grooming more frequently during high-shedding seasons and peak outdoor activity months. And always ensure your pet is up-to-date on vaccinations for everyone’s safety.
